Output ed8cf00a5d9ccf66dffbb258304b79c8a7dfa1dc1decd9117e53d324e73f4ac0:0

value
43896
script pubkey
OP_0 OP_PUSHBYTES_20 155ba662b4dc76bacc9d49820809eb658fd70ac8
address
bc1qz4d6vc45m3mt4nyafxpqsz0tvk8awzkg0u87v6
transaction
ed8cf00a5d9ccf66dffbb258304b79c8a7dfa1dc1decd9117e53d324e73f4ac0
confirmations
1446
spent
true